They are completely different.

One is against family, friends, co-workers and bragging rights. The games haven’t historically meant a whole lot, but you never want to lose. It’s more good natured ribbing.. water cooler talk..

The other is just fricking awesome. You know you are going to get your arse locked sometimes, but it’s a fricking battle. It’s doesn’t matter how good your team is, or what your record is, or what your ranked.. you want to skull frick every single one of them and bury them alive. It’s intense hatred at the fair. You don’t get that on here because most of us don’t know many of the other fans.

Idk if that makes sense.

If I had to pick one.. I’m always going to be Oklahoma. That doesn’t mean that A&M isn’t as important.. it is.. it’s just different.

I would choose to play both forever.

They always say OU but it's mainly just a once a year game in the middle of the year to them. Other than that the Sips and Sooners are best buddies with the Sooners gladly doing whatever Texas tells them to do.

All of their traditions though are about A&M. Texas Fight is based on Farmer's Fight. They came up with their hand sign to counter ours. They took their nickname Longhorns from our original yearbook. They named it BEVO after we stole it and branded it 13-0 and that was the best they could do to cover it. They had a Hex Rally to counter our Bonfire.

The funniest thing to me is how they insist that OU is their real rival when they obsess about us and will run to threads like this to scream how OU is really the one they hate.
